Name Census estimates that about 250 living Americans carry the first name Peyson. It appears on both sides of the gender split, with 50.4% of registrations being female. The average person named Peyson today is around 11 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Peyson births was 2012 (35 babies).

Peyson is one of the more evenly split names in the SSA data. Of the 252 total registrations, 125 (49.6%) were male and 127 (50.4%) were female.

How many people in the U.S. are named Peyson?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 250 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Peyson going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 1,371,017 US residents.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
